Title: Boosting Agricultural Efficiency: Subsidies on Drip & Sprinkler Irrigation under Pradhan Mantri Krishi Sinchayee Yojana

Introduction:
India is an agrarian nation heavily dependent on agriculture as a primary source of livelihood and sustenance. However, the agricultural sector often faces challenges related to dwindling water resources, unpredictable weather patterns, and inefficient irrigation practices. In an endeavour to mitigate these challenges and enhance agricultural efficiency, the Indian government introduced the Pradhan Mantri Krishi Sinchayee Yojana (PMKSY) with a focus on promoting drip and sprinkler irrigation. This article delves into the subsidization of these irrigation methods under the PMKSY and highlights their benefits for Indian farmers.

Understanding PMKSY:
The Pradhan Mantri Krishi Sinchayee Yojana, launched in 2015, aims to achieve water security and an efficient irrigation system for farmers across India. The program functions under the Ministry of Agriculture and Farmers’ Welfare and focuses on enhancing water-use efficiency, ensuring the conservation of water resources, and expanding irrigation coverage. Under the PMKSY, subsidies are provided to encourage and support the adoption of drip and sprinkler irrigation methods.

Subsidies on Drip Irrigation:
Drip irrigation is a method of delivering water directly to the roots of plants through a network of tubes, allowing for precise and efficient water usage. Recognizing the importance of drip irrigation, the PMKSY extends generous subsidies to farmers who choose to adopt this method. These subsidies cover a significant portion of the installation cost, ensuring that the financial burden on the farmers is reduced substantially.

The benefits of drip irrigation are manifold. It minimizes water wastage by supplying water directly to plant roots, reducing evaporation and run-off. Additionally, it helps maintain soil moisture levels, prevents weed growth, lowers labor requirements, and even promotes healthier plant growth, ultimately leading to higher yields. By subsidizing and promoting the usage of drip irrigation, the PMKSY aims to revolutionize irrigation techniques, conserve water, and improve the overall wellbeing of farmers.

Subsidies on Sprinkler Irrigation:
Sprinkler irrigation is another technique supported under the PMKSY, as it too presents several advantages. In this method, water is distributed through a system of pipes and sprinkler heads, simulating rainfall over the crop’s foliage and soil. Sprinkler irrigation facilitates effective water coverage, reduces water consumption, and provides uniform distribution.

Through the PMKSY, the government offers generous subsidies to aid farmers in installing sprinkler irrigation systems. These subsidies typically cover a significant portion of the cost, thereby encouraging farmers to adopt this water-saving and efficient irrigation method. By enabling farmers to shift from traditional flood irrigation practices to sprinkler systems, the government aims to boost the productivity of agriculture, improve crop yield, reduce water wastage, and ultimately enhance farmers’ profitability.
